“Tips for Creating Teams” – How can I entice my friends to join my team?
· Build a “Team of Twenty” of work acquaintances and friends who commit to raising $100 each, either by writing a check for that amount or asking their friends to donate.
· Ask members of your social groups, book clubs, church, hobby groups to join with you to form a team.
· If you work for a large company, form more than one team and have them compete against one another.
· Supply your friends with information about the Northwest Pilot Project and let them know how much their help will do for those in need. Promise them a nice walk, pizza and fun.
What do team captains do?
· Come up with a team name
· Recruit and encourage individuals to raise pledges
· Write TEAM name at the top of your Sponsor Sheets
